RELEASE OF PRISONERS

REPORT ASKED FOR The Minister for Justice (the Hon. F. J. Rolleston) stated yesterday that the Government has asked the Prisons Board for a report setting out the principles on -which the board acts in recommending the release of prisoners and dealing with the facts in regard to the cases of Baume, Mackay, And Baker. This report will probably not be available until after the next meeting of the board, which is fixed for the second week in December; hut it will he published as soon as received.
